async def _get_pubsub_message(
self, pubsub: PubSub, timeout: float | None = None
) -> None:
"""Get lock release events from the pubsub.
Args:
pubsub: The pubsub to get a message from.
timeout: Remaining time to wait for a message.
Returns:
The message.
"""
if timeout is None:
timeout = self.lock_expiration / 1000.0
started = time.time()
message = await pubsub.get_message(
ignore_subscribe_messages=True,
timeout=timeout,
)
if (
message is None
or message["data"] not in self._redis_keyspace_lock_release_events
):
remaining = timeout - (time.time() - started)
if remaining <= 0:
return
await self._get_pubsub_message(pubsub, timeout=remaining)
